Information about the Author

John Williams (1922-1994) was born and raised in Northeast Texas. Despite his talent for writing and acting, Williams failed after his first year at a local junior college. Reluctantly, he enlisted in the war and joined the Army Air Corps, where he managed to draft his first novel. After returning, Williams found a small publisher for the novel and enrolled at the University of Denver, where he eventually earned both his B.A. and M.A. and returned as a lecturer in 1954. Williams remained part of the faculty of the creative writing program at the University of Denver until his retirement in 1985. During these years, he was an active guest lecturer and writer, publishing two collections of poetry and three novels: "Butcher's Crossing," "Stoner," and the National Book Award-winning "Augustus.".
